DREAM-High: Introduction to R
`R` is a programming language and free software environment for statistical computing and graphics. It's not only a powerful statistical programming language but also the go-to data analysis tool for many computational genomics experts. We will explore how high-dimensional genomics datasets can be analyzed with core R packages and functions.
DREAM-High: Finding Patterns with Heatmaps
Large biological datasets are often too big to understand by reading numbers in a table. In DREAM-High, we will eventually use heatmaps to look for patterns in breast cancer gene expression data from patients in The Cancer Genome Atlas. A heatmap can help us ask questions such as:
- Which samples look similar to each other?
- Which genes behave similarly across patients?
- Can visual patterns help us discover tumor subtypes?
Today we will learn the same basic idea using a small practice dataset that comes with R.
